Transaction 804295c0525824c89e829b74229eeb645ddfcb6697a263c84470e9e6c0784c19

11 Input
2 Outputs
  • 804295c0525824c89e829b74229eeb645ddfcb6697a263c84470e9e6c0784c19:0
  • value  999354
    address  3GTG5Xi3wJ4X5hJ99dBB6zYYvChY1FyE8C
  • 804295c0525824c89e829b74229eeb645ddfcb6697a263c84470e9e6c0784c19:1
  • value  61796063
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te